The Ultimate Guide to Building a Successful Design System for Product Designers
As product designers, it's our job to create design systems that are intuitive, functional, and beautiful. But creating a successful design system is no easy feat – it takes a lot of planning, research, and testing to get it right. To help you avoid some common pitfalls and create a killer design system, we've compiled a list of the best tips for product designers.
- Define your design principles. Before diving into the nitty-gritty details of your design system, take some time to define your design principles. These principles should reflect the goals and values of your product and provide guidance for the entire design team.
- Conduct thorough user research. User research is crucial for understanding the needs, pain points, and preferences of your target audience. Make sure to conduct in-depth research to inform your design decisions and create a system that meets the needs of your users.
- Create a style guide. A style guide is an essential component of any design system, providing a clear and consistent set of rules for design elements such as colors, fonts, and icons. Be sure to create a comprehensive style guide that covers all aspects of your design.
- Use the right tools and resources. To create a successful design system, you need the right tools and resources. Invest in high-quality design software, templates, and other resources to make the design process smoother and more efficient.
- Collaborate with your team. Designing a design system is a team effort, so make sure to collaborate with your fellow designers and other stakeholders. By working together, you can create a system that's cohesive, consistent, and reflective of the collective vision of your team.
- Test, test, test. Testing is a crucial step in the design process, and it's especially important when it comes to design systems. Make sure to conduct usability testing, user testing, and other types of testing to ensure your system is effective and user-friendly.
- Be flexible and adaptable. A design system is not a static document – it's a living, breathing entity that should be constantly iterated and improved. Be open to feedback, suggestions, and changes from your team and users, and be willing to adapt and improve your system over time.
- Keep things simple and intuitive. When designing a design system, it's easy to get carried away and add too many elements, rules, and guidelines. But remember: simplicity is key. Keep your system simple and intuitive, and avoid adding unnecessary complexity.
- Stay up to date with design trends. Design trends are constantly evolving, and it's important to stay on top of the latest trends to create a modern and contemporary design system.